Why Your Station Might Be Missing
If you can't find your station, there are a few possible reasons:
- New station — if you were recently appointed by PennDOT, there may be a lag before your station appears in our data
- Non-public classification — some stations in PennDOT's records are classified as non-public (e.g., fleet-only stations) and may not be included
- Data update timing — our database is updated periodically from PennDOT records. Newly appointed stations may take a cycle to appear.
- Name or address mismatch — your business may operate under a different name than what's in PennDOT's records
